Na472 2024-09-14 14:39 采纳率: 51.4%
浏览 1
已结题

绘制er图 数据库应用

绘制实验项目的的E-R图形
实验项目:
某医院欲使用计算机对住院病人进行科学管理,其中涉及到的对象及属性如下所示:
医生:姓名,性别,出生日期,职称,科室,职称,医生工号
病人:病人编号,姓名,性别,出生日期,缴费情况,缴费金额,病症
病房:病房号,床位号,床位数

  • 写回答

1条回答 默认 最新

  • 一轮明月照丘壑 2024-09-14 14:40
    关注

    以下回复参考:皆我百晓生券券喵儿等免费微信小程序作答:

    根据您提供的描述,这是一个关于医院管理系统的实体关系图(E-R图)。下面是基于您给出的实体和属性的E-R图描述及绘制建议:

    实体(Entity):

    1. 医生 (Doctor)
    2. 病人 (Patient)
    3. 病房 (Ward)

    属性(Attributes):

    • 医生:
      • 姓名 (Name)
      • 性别 (Gender)
      • 出生日期 (DateOfBirth)
      • 职称 (Profession)
      • 科室 (Department)
      • 工号 (DoctorID)
    • 病人:
      • 病人编号 (PatientID)
      • 姓名 (Name)
      • 性别 (Gender)
      • 出生日期 (DateOfBirth)
      • 缴费情况 (PaymentStatus)
      • 缴费金额 (PaymentAmount)
      • 病症 (Disease)
    • 病房:
      • 病房号 (WardNumber)
      • 床位号 (BedNumber)
      • 床位数 (NumberOfBeds)

    关系(Relationships):

    1. 医生与病人之间可能存在“治疗”(Treat)关系。表示医生为病人进行治疗。但注意,在ER图中通常不表示具体治疗行为,而是展示实体之间的关系。如果需要,可以在文字描述中补充细节。
    2. 病人可能入住病房,所以病人与病房之间存在“入住”(StayIn)关系。这里我们可以考虑一个病房可以有多个病人入住,所以这是一个多对多的关系。如果需要进一步细化,可以添加具体的入住日期和离店日期等属性。但在简单的ER图中,我们只关注实体间的关系类型。在绘制ER图时,可以通过连线来表示这种关系。例如,从病人的矩形框到病房的矩形框画一条线表示他们之间的入住关系。同时在线旁边标注“入住”。对于医生和病人的治疗关系也可以采用类似的方式表示。对于实体内部的属性,可以在各自的矩形框内列出。例如,“医生”矩形框内列出“姓名”、“性别”等属性。以下是基于上述描述的ER图草图:ER图是一个图形表示工具,所以在这里无法提供具体的绘图步骤或图片格式,但您可以使用任何绘图工具(如Visio、数据库设计工具等)来绘制ER图或创建逻辑结构模型。请注意ER图的精确性和完整性需要按照实际业务逻辑和设计要求进行详细定义和调整。同时考虑到关系型数据库的设计原则(如主键、外键等),确保数据库的完整性和安全性。
    评论

报告相同问题?

问题事件

  • 已结题 (查看结题原因) 9月26日
  • 创建了问题 9月14日

悬赏问题

  • ¥15 35114 SVAC视频验签的问题
  • ¥15 impedancepy
  • ¥15 在虚拟机环境下完成以下,要求截图!
  • ¥15 求往届大挑得奖作品(ppt…)
  • ¥15 如何在vue.config.js中读取到public文件夹下window.APP_CONFIG.API_BASE_URL的值
  • ¥50 浦育平台scratch图形化编程
  • ¥20 求这个的原理图 只要原理图
  • ¥15 vue2项目中,如何配置环境,可以在打完包之后修改请求的服务器地址
  • ¥20 微信的店铺小程序如何修改背景图
  • ¥15 UE5.1局部变量对蓝图不可见